PORT-AU-PRINCE, Haiti - Gunmen fired Sunday on thousands of protesters demanding the prosecution of Jean-Bertrand Aristide, drawing return fire from U.S. Marines and leaving at least five people dead in the worst attack since the Haitian president's ouster.
Demonstrators scattered as shots crackled across the vast Champs de Mars plaza in front of the presidential National Palace. Police ducked into doorways.
